How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Sutter?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Sutter Studio Apartments | $912 | $675 | $1,175 |
Sutter 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,282 | $468 | $1,720 |
Sutter 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,487 | $472 | $2,000 |
Sutter 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,246 | $548 | $2,000 |
Sutter 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,178 | $605 | $1,469 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Sutter
How much are Studio apartments in Sutter?
There are currently 2 Studio Apartments in Sutter with rent ranges from $675 to $1,175 with an average price of $912.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Sutter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Sutter ranges from $468 to $1,720 with an average monthly rent of $1,282.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Sutter c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Sutter range from $472 to $2,000.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,487.
How expensive are Sutter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 8 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Sutter on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$548 to $2,000 - averaging $1,246 for the location.
